Automated inspection using artificial intelligence

Building on its 40 years of experience in measurement, Novika adds applied AI expertise to develop automated inspection systems that achieve very high levels of accuracy and rapid execution.

For example, in the wood industry, product quality assessment and grading most often rely on the expertise of trained employees. These employees must quickly identify any defects and determine whether they affect the product’s grade. With high production rates, errors are inevitable, especially after several hours of work.

To provide a simple and productive solution, the Novika team has developed a technology based on deep learning techniques, including convolutional neural networks (CNNs), to analyze images of wood components. The neural networks are trained to locate and evaluate anomalies such as knots, cracks, and holes, enabling rapid and accurate defect detection.

This approach improves the commercial value of products derived from raw materials, reduces waste, ensures more efficient quality control, and minimizes losses due to errors in materials inspection.

Novika thus provides its partners with a highly effective solution that can be implemented in a variety of industrial infrastructures.
